Castle Craig, perched atop the picturesque Hubbard Park in Meriden, Connecticut, invites tourists to explore its rich history and breathtaking views. This iconic stone tower, designed in the early 20th century, offers visitors a glimpse into the past while providing a stunning vantage point of the surrounding landscape. The lush park surrounding the tower is perfect for leisurely strolls, picnics, and outdoor activities, making it an ideal destination for families and history enthusiasts alike.

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Castle Craig.
- Visit during the early morning or late afternoon for the best lighting and fewer crowds.
- Wear comfortable shoes for the climb up the tower and the surrounding hiking trails.
- Bring a picnic to enjoy in the park after your visit to the tower.
- Check the weather forecast before your visit for the best visibility from the tower.
- Explore the park’s other attractions, including walking paths and beautiful gardens.
